Sapphire, transparent to translucent, natural or synthetic variety of corundum (q.v. Aluminum oxide, al2o3) that has been highly prized as a gemstone since about 800 bc. As a sibling to the ruby, the sapphire shares its value, appeal, and scarcity They are both members of the corundum family with rubies being red and sapphires covering all the other colors
Sapphires are famously blue, but yellow, green, or purple versions are objects of true wonder.
